What Is a Comfort Control Module?

The Comfort Control Module is an electronic control unit responsible for managing a wide range of interior and convenience functions in the vehicle. Located typically under the dashboard or beneath the driver’s footwell, this module serves as the central brain for many of the systems that directly affect the driver’s and passengers’ daily experience. Some of the systems controlled or coordinated by the CCM include: Power window operation Central locking and unlocking Interior lighting control Electric mirror adjustment and folding Remote keyless entry and immobilizer Alarm and anti-theft systems Sunroof operation Rain sensors and automatic wiper control By overseeing these systems, the CCM helps create a seamless, intuitive experience that makes modern driving feel effortless.

The Integration with Other Vehicle Systems

Modern vehicles are increasingly integrated, and the Comfort Control Module often communicates with other onboard systems via the CAN (Controller Area Network) bus. This allows the CCM to work in coordination with: Security systems, ensuring proper arming or disarming based on door lock status. Climate control modules, triggering cabin pre-conditioning if the vehicle is remotely unlocked or started. Lighting systems, activating ambient or entry lights based on door status or time of day. Infotainment systems, allowing the driver to customize comfort settings from the touchscreen interface. This interconnectedness means that a fault in the CCM can sometimes present symptoms that appear unrelated — like windows that won’t roll down, interior lights that stay on, or doors that randomly unlock.

Signs of a Failing Comfort Control Module

Because the CCM manages so many subsystems, a malfunctioning module can produce a wide range of symptoms. Common signs of failure include: Non-functional central locking Windows or mirrors not responding Key fob not unlocking or locking the vehicle Inconsistent interior lighting behavior Alarm triggering randomly Battery drain due to components staying powered when they shouldn’t If you’re experiencing multiple electrical anomalies in your car’s interior, it’s often a sign that the CCM should be inspected or diagnosed by a professional.

Why the CCM Is More Important Than You Think

The name “Comfort Control Module” can be misleading. In reality, this system plays a pivotal role in both convenience and core daily operations. In the past, vehicles managed each of these functions separately, using standalone relays and switches. The CCM revolutionized this by centralizing control, reducing wiring complexity, and enabling smarter automation and coordination.
